What Most Buyers Get Wrong

Convection Fan Power Matters

When evaluating air fryer convection ovens, the Super Convection technology, like that found in the Breville Smart Oven Air Fryer Pro (product 1) and the Breville Smart Oven Air Fryer (product 6), is a key differentiator. This refers to more powerful fans that circulate air much faster, significantly reducing cooking times by up to 30% and ensuring more even browning and crisping. Cheaper models might have a single convection fan, like the Midea Flexify (product 3), which offers good heat evenness but might not achieve the same speed or crispiness.

Capacity for Family-Sized Meals

One major consideration for air fryer convection ovens is internal capacity, especially if you’re cooking for more than one or two people. The Ninja French Door Premier Air Fry Oven (product 4) boasts the largest air frying capacity in a French door oven, fitting up to 5 lbs of fries. Similarly, the Cuisinart 15-in-1 Extra-Large Digital Air Fryer Oven (product 7) is specifically highlighted for its extra-large interior, capable of air frying 4 lbs of wings.

This is crucial for avoiding crowded air fry baskets, which prevent proper circulation and lead to unevenly cooked food.

What to Look For in the Best Air Fryer Convection Oven

Capacity and size

For households of one or two, a compact model with an interior capacity under 1.5 cubic feet is ideal, easily accommodating single servings or smaller meals. Larger families or those who entertain frequently should opt for units offering 3.0 cubic feet or more, capable of fitting a whole chicken or a 13×9 inch baking pan. Always verify external dimensions to ensure a proper fit on your countertop.

Prioritize larger tray or rack sizes, looking for at least an 8-inch width for versatile cooking. A 2.5 cubic feet capacity is the sweet spot for most families.

Power and temperature range

When choosing a convection oven, a wattage of 1700W or higher delivers superior performance, ensuring faster preheating and more even cooking. Look for models with a maximum temperature of at least 400°F for optimal searing and crisping. If you plan to dehydrate or slow cook, a minimum temperature setting of around 100°F is essential.

Higher wattage units consistently outperform lower ones, providing the power needed for a wide range of cooking techniques. Aim for a power output between 1700W and 2000W for the best results.

Cooking presets and functions

Consider a model with at least 5 core cooking presets including bake, broil, roast, toast, and air fry to handle most everyday cooking needs. While numerous presets can be appealing, robust manual control over time and temperature is more important for flexibility. Look for distinct convection fan settings, such as a high-speed option for crisping and a lower-speed setting for gentler cooking.

A unit with 5 to 7 versatile presets and precise manual controls will serve you best for diverse culinary tasks.

Ease of use and cleaning

Digital displays with intuitive controls offer superior precision and ease of operation compared to analog dials. Ensure your chosen appliance includes essential accessories like a drip tray and crisper basket for optimal air frying. For effortless cleanup, prioritize models with dishwasher-safe components and a nonstick interior coating.

A unit that combines a clear digital interface with readily cleanable parts significantly enhances the user experience. Select an oven that makes both cooking and cleaning straightforward.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Is The Primary Advantage Of An Air Fryer Convection Oven Over A Standard Oven?

An air fryer convection oven circulates hot air more efficiently, leading to faster cooking and crispier results than a traditional oven. This enhanced air movement is key to achieving air-fried textures within a larger oven format. It provides greater versatility in the kitchen for various cooking methods.

How Does The Capacity Of An Air Fryer Convection Oven Impact Its Usefulness?

The capacity, measured in cubic feet, determines how much food you can cook at once, making larger ovens ideal for families or meal prepping. Smaller capacities are suitable for individuals or smaller portions. Choosing the right size ensures efficient cooking without overcrowding.

What Role Does Wattage Play In The Performance Of An Air Fryer Convection Oven?

Higher wattage in an air fryer convection oven typically translates to faster preheating and cooking times. It provides the power needed for effective convection and crisping. Models with adequate wattage, generally 1500W or higher, offer better performance for most cooking tasks.

Are Specific Cooking Presets Beneficial In An Air Fryer Convection Oven?

Yes, specific cooking presets simplify meal preparation by automatically adjusting time and temperature for common foods like toast, pizza, or chicken. This convenience helps users achieve optimal results even without manual settings. Many users find these presets incredibly helpful for everyday cooking.

How Important Is The Temperature Range For Versatility In An Air Fryer Convection Oven?

A wide temperature range, from low settings for dehydrating to high settings for searing (e.g., up to 450°F), significantly boosts versatility. This allows for a broader array of cooking methods, from slow cooking to crisping. It ensures the appliance can handle diverse culinary needs.
